在升级中测试Install4j回滚

阿米特

我正在使用install4j的“无版本检查更新程序”来实现无提示升级。对于否定情况,我想测试在任何故障情况下的回滚是否都有效。因此,我想以某种方式明确地使升级失败并测试回滚是否正常。

那么,有什么方法可以明确地使升级失败并测试回滚?在build install4j方法中或其他方法中。

英戈·凯格尔

您可以使用以下脚本在所需的故障点添加“运行脚本”操作:

false

并将其失败策略设置为“退出失败”。

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

无论我已经克服了哪些回滚障碍,如何在Install4j中执行回滚操作?

来自分类Dev

Install4j:运行批处理文件/脚本文件以进行回滚操作

来自分类Dev

Install4j:运行批处理文件/脚本文件以进行回滚操作

来自分类Dev

升级时不会删除install4j过时的文件

来自分类Dev

使用Junit测试install4j安装程序的行为

来自分类Dev

我们是否应该始终将对象设置回Install4j中的上下文?

来自分类Dev

如何更改install4j中捆绑的JRE的位置?

来自分类Dev

在install4j应用程序中强制更新

来自分类Dev

在install4j中添加自定义按钮

来自分类Dev

如何在install4j中启用Keyboard Accelerator

来自分类Dev

在install4j中,executeScheduleUpdate如何工作?

来自分类Dev

如何在install4j中更改标题/字幕?

来自分类Dev

在install4j中设置Windows环境变量

来自分类Dev

Mac OS X上的Install4j JRE位于.install4j / jre.bundle中

来自分类Dev

Mac OS X上的Install4j JRE位于.install4j / jre.bundle中

来自分类Dev

回滚升级

来自分类Dev

Neo4j-交易回滚

来自分类Dev

在黄瓜JVM测试中回滚事务

来自分类Dev

在弹簧测试中插入后回滚

来自分类Dev

Is install4j jdk 8 compatible?

来自分类Dev

install4j:执行bash文件

来自分类Dev

Install4j Mac OSx签名

来自分类Dev

Install4j还原版本

来自分类Dev

Install4j:安装服务

来自分类Dev

Install4j还原版本

来自分类Dev

install4j 的代码签名错误

来自分类Dev

如何在 Neo4j 中撤消/重做/回滚?

来自分类Dev

在install4j中,安装程序可以具有与启动器不同的图标吗?

来自分类Dev

在Install4J中是否可以更新sys.preferredJRE变量?